C++学习第2课,笔记

1 类



成员变量

成员函数

private://私有的

public://公有的

*1 公有函数修改私有变量;

*2 公有函数调用this->[变量]



代码

#include <stdio.h>

class person{

private:

char *name;

int age;

char *work;

public:

void setname(char* name)

{

this->name = name;

}

int setage(int age)

{

if(150 > age > 0)

{

this->age = age;

return 1;

}

else

{

return 0;

}

}

void printInfo(void)

{

printf("name = %s, age = %d, work = %s\n",name,age,work);

}

};

int main(int argc, char **argv)

{

person per;

per.setage(15);

per.setname("zhangsan");

per.printInfo();

return 0;

}

第二课结束

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 小类型向大类型转换 不同类型的数据经常出现相互转换的现象. 1, 在Java中小类型向大类型的转换会自动完成, 即...
    o0寳贝阅读 415评论 0 0
  • DAY 05 1、 public classArrayDemo { public static void mai...
    周书达阅读 745评论 0 0
  • 1.OC里用到集合类是什么? 基本类型为:NSArray,NSSet以及NSDictionary 可变类型为:NS...
    轻皱眉头浅忧思阅读 1,394评论 0 3
  • 1.#import和#include的区别 @class?@class一般用于头文件中需要声明该类的某个实例变量的...
    晚照清舟阅读 327评论 0 0
  • 今年的夏天比往年要热很多,应该说是 每年的夏天都会比去年的热。就像每次考试前 老师家长都会满怀希望的叮嘱你 一定要...
    小天黑阅读 219评论 0 1